单据扩展字段能否在审批中或者审批通过状态进行修改
[适用版本]:8.2,8.5,8.5sp1
[解决方案]:
日常中,人事的流程经常有这样的场景:不同审批人看到的单据信息需要隔离、不同审批环节需要修改某些敏感字段,又不能让其他环节的参与人看到
如:转正单据 ,上级评语、 转正后薪资、考核成绩和转正后职等信息
这些信息,不想要员工自己填写,故员工提交单据时这些字段是要控制只读或者是不能显示的。
上级评语字段是需要直接上级领导审批环节填写的。
转正后薪资字段是HR审批环节填写的。
以8.5转正单据为例,目前我们s-HR系统的转正单据表单有多张:
1、个人提交 (员工自助——我要转正)表单,打开的是com.kingdee.eas.hr.affair.app.EmpHireBizBill.form这个视图的表单
2、专员提交(员工管理——员工变动管理——转正)表单 ,打开的是com.kingdee.eas.hr.affair.app.EmpHireBizBill.formAll这个视图的表单
3、流程中心待办审批页面打开的单据视图是com.kingdee.eas.hr.affair.app.EmpHireBizBill.formAudit
问题1,自定义的字段,个人能看到,审批节点看不到,就需要在审批环节的视图上加上这些字段com.kingdee.eas.hr.affair.app.EmpHireBizBill.formAudit
问题2,自定义的字段,个人能看到,专员看不到,就需要专员的视图上加上这些字段com.kingdee.eas.hr.affair.app.EmpHireBizBill.formAll
问题3,[转正后薪资]这个字段,只希望HR薪酬专员审批环节能看到并可以编辑。则需要在流程图绘制的时候设置。
1、首先需要新建一个视图,参照个人的(com.kingdee.eas.hr.affair.app.EmpHireBizBill.form)或者专员的视图(com.kingdee.eas.hr.affair.app.EmpHireBizBill.formAll),除了视图的名称,uri不一样,其他的一模一样。然后在视图内容上 将[转正后薪资]这个字段 加上,并设置可编辑即可
如图:
2、流程绘制时,在审批节点任务中设置“自定义Web单据” 在自定义Web单据界面栏填入单据url,格式如下:/shr/dynamic.do?uipk=com.kingdee.eas.hr.affair.app.EmpHireBizBill.formHR_test&isShrBill=true,界面状态设置为可编辑。
3、其他审批节点如也需要自定义审批单据界面。参照上一步设置即可
参考链接 https://vip.kingdee.com/article/175529
单据扩展字段能否在审批中或者审批通过状态进行修改
本文2024-09-22 20:41:21发表“s-hr cloud知识”栏目。
本文链接:https://wenku.my7c.com/article/kingdee-shr-115253.html